Compound Pharmacies: Tailoring Medication for Individual Needs

Compounding pharmacies play a pivotal role in delivering customized medications. Unlike traditional pharmacies that provide pre-manufactured drugs, compounding pharmacists create medication mixtures tailored to a patient's specific needs. This allows for improved control over formulations, dosage forms, and even flavors, ensuring that medications are optimally delivered and comfortable to take.

For patients who have difficulty swallowing pills, compound pharmacies can prepare liquid or chewable medications. Patients with allergies or sensitivities to certain ingredients in commercial drugs can benefit from alternative formulations that omit those problematic substances. Compound pharmacies also manufacture specialized preparations for children, elderly patients, and pets, ensuring that medications are safe for their individual needs.

  • Moreover, compounding pharmacies can aid patients who require non-standard dosages or unique medication combinations.
  • These flexibility and customization enable compound pharmacies a valuable resource for individuals seeking personalized healthcare solutions.

Traditional Dispensing and Compounding Pharmacies: A Comparison

When requiring medications tailored to your specific needs, you'll encounter two primary avenues: standard drugstores and compounding pharmacies. Traditional dispensing typically involves filling pre-made medications from established manufacturers. On the other hand, compounding pharmacies craft customized medications based on a physician's prescription. This distinction allows for specialized formulations to address individual requirements, reactions, or preferred administrations.

Grasping Active Pharmaceutical Ingredients (APIs) in Everyday Medications

Active pharmaceutical ingredients manufacture, or APIs, are the key components found within your medications. These substances are liable for providing the therapeutic effect that patients strive to achieve.

APIs come in a wide range of forms, including both organic and inorganic compounds. They are rigorously tested for safety and efficacy before being incorporated into formulations.

  • Understanding the role of APIs can empower individuals to make more informed decisions about their health.
  • Frequent examples of APIs include aspirin for pain relief, and antibiotics like amoxicillin to treat bacterial infections.
